    Pick n Pay Graduate Demand Planner Details

    The Role and Responsibilities

    As a Graduate Demand Planner at Pick n Pay’s Kenilworth office in Cape Town, you will play a vital role in ensuring that the right products are available on the shelves at the right time. Your responsibilities will be diverse, allowing you to engage in both analytics and demand planning activities. Approximately 60% of your time will be dedicated to analytical tasks, involving the examination of stock flow patterns, trend identification, deduction-making, and solution generation. The remaining 40% will focus on demand planning, where you will set and maintain forecasts for new sites and vendors across various articles. Additionally, you will monitor and adjust orders to align with forecast plans, address anomalies, and ensure accurate stock levels during promotions.

     

    Qualifications and Requirements

    To be considered for this exciting role, you need to meet certain minimum requirements:

    • Successful completion of Mathematics in Matric
    • Possession of one or more of the following higher education qualifications:
      • Degree in Quantitative Analytics
      • Degree in Operational Research
      • Degree in Industrial Engineering
      • Degree in Applied Mathematics
      • Degree in Economics
    • Proficiency in Advanced Excel would be a valuable asset

     

    Key Competencies

    The Graduate Demand Planner role at Pick n Pay requires a unique set of skills and attributes to excel. Here are some competencies that will contribute to your success in this position:

    1. Conceptual Thinking: The ability to analyse complex situations, spot trends, and generate innovative solutions is crucial for effective demand planning and stock management.
    2. People Orientation: Collaborating with various stakeholders, including vendors, stores, and colleagues, requires excellent interpersonal skills and a customer-centric approach.
    3. Planning and Organising: Effective demand planning involves juggling multiple tasks and deadlines. Strong organisational skills will help you stay on top of your responsibilities.
    4. Time Management: Prioritising tasks and managing your time efficiently will ensure that stock levels are maintained accurately and promotions are executed seamlessly.
    5. Systems Centric: Comfort with using various supply chain management systems and tools is essential for accurate data analysis and order management.
    6. Results Oriented: A commitment to achieving targets and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) is essential for meeting demand and ensuring optimal stock levels.
    7. Passion for Retail: An interest in the retail industry and a deep understanding of consumer behaviour will aid in anticipating demand and planning accordingly.
    8. Resilience: The ability to adapt to changing circumstances, especially during unexpected demand fluctuations, is crucial for maintaining efficient stock levels.
    9. Accountability: Taking ownership of your tasks and decisions will contribute to the overall success of demand planning within the organisation.
